Bryan ... I couldn't help but notice this thread. I can't answer your query excatly, but I sure can share a couple of things I've seen in capo use lately. Last Fall, in Seattle, the great Alice Stuart gave us a concert during which she played with TWO capos at the same time. As I saw her setting it up, I started to think that she must be making a mistake. I soon learned it was NO mistake and she used BOTH capos to great effect.

Then ... a couple of months later, I saw a guy do one song at an open Mike in Seattle using THREE capos at the same time. And all these capos were full capos ... none of the pieces were mising!

I know I'm really old, and I change my habits very reluctantly, but this blew me away.
